Predicates and their Subjects is an in-depth examine of the syntax-semantics interface concentrating on the constitution of the subject-predicate relation. ranging from the place the author's 1983 dissertation left off, the e-book argues that there's syntactic constraint that clauses (small and tensed) are built out of a one-place unsaturated expression, the predicate, which needs to be utilized to a syntactic argument, its topic. the writer exhibits that this predication relation can't be decreased to a thematic relation or a projection of argument constitution, yet has to be a basically syntactic constraint. Chapters within the ebook convey how the syntactic predication relation is semantically interpreted, and the way the predication relation explains constraints on DP-raising and at the distribution of pleonastics in English. the second one half the e-book extends the speculation of predication to hide copular buildings; it comprises an account of the constitution of small clauses in Hebrew, of using `be' in predicative and identification sentences in English, and concludes with a research of the which means of the verb `be'.
